Pumpkin-shaped Sourdough Boule

This is a trend that I’ve been seeing recently on some of the bread-baking sites that I follow: shaping a regular loaf of bread (a standard boule) into a pumpkin loaf. There is nothing pumpkin or pumpkin-spice flavored about this bread: it is just a regular loaf of my standard artisan sourdough bread. But to make it a little festive, you can imprint the loaf by loosely tying cooking twine around it before baking. I used a cinnamon stick as the “stem” just to complete the look. Makes a nice presentation for a harvest / autumn / Thanksgiving meal.

Cocoa Krispies Mummy Bars

I’ve been meaning to make these Cocoa Krispies Bar Mummies for a couple of years now, but somehow Halloween has rolled around and either I’ve forgotten or I was already working on the Cookies and didn’t have time to run to the shops for the ingredients. But here we are: meltingly soft cocoa krispies bars (the trick is adding a bit of condensed milk) with white chocolate coating, cute little eyeballs.

Harvest Dark Chocolate Sugar Cookie Acorns

Back in 2013, I made these little Sugar Cookie Kiss “Acorns” and somehow was reminded of that over the weekend, so I updated the recipe and here we go again. It’s a simple, and not too time consuming way to make little treats for autumn and might be cute for Thanksgiving or Friendsgiving. I used the Hershey’s Special Dark Kisses, but you could also use the Almond or Caramel Filled ones!

A note about the photo: before anyone gets all pedantic on me, I know that “acorns” don’t come from maple trees, but maple leaves are prettier than oak leaves, so deal with it! 🙂
